TC1 titanium alloy with high plasticity, thermal stability and weldability, can be used stably under high temperature condition in the field of aerospace. During the plastic deformation process, texture is always performed in TC1 titanium, which leads to the anisotropy which affects its mechanical properties and processabilities. Therefore, controling or eliminating the effect of texture has become an important topic for nowadays material researches.In present paper, TC1 titanium plate is cold rolled by different reduction. For 65% reduction TC1 titanium cold rolled plate, different annealings are conducted by which deformation texture and recrystallization texture are investigated. And further, effects of texture on the static and dynamic mechanical property are studied. Meanwhile, both texture evolution and effects of texture of TC1 titanium rod on the static and dynamic mechanical property are also investigated in order to provide theoretical support and help for the process and manufacture of TC1 titanium products.The results showe that intense basal {0002} texture and split-basal {0002} texture are formed during cold rolled of different reduction, and the {0002} texture consists of {0002}<10-10> and {0002}<11-20> components. And {-2112}<2-1-13> texture is also formed in the cold rolled plate with 65% reduction. During the recrystallization of TC1 cold rolled plate with high reduction, recrystallization texture inherite the deformation texture, i.e. {0002} texture, which resultes from Oriented Nucleation and Oriented Growth. The lowΣ12 andΣ11 value CSL(Coincident Site Lattice) grain boundaries correspond to the {0002}<11-20> and {0002}<10-10> play an important role during {0002} texture formation. Heat rate has a great inference on the process of recrystallization, salt bath furnace heat treatment could promote the recrystallization, while stage annealing postpones it. By static tension, compression and dynamic impact, the result shows that {0002} texture has an intense effect on the anisotropy. Parallel to the RD, the specimen has a good elongation percentage and contraction cross sectional area, while the specimen parallel to the ND holds higher compression strength. A large number of twins are found to coordinate the external deformation in the specimen parallel to the TD and RD during compression and specimens parallel to the ND, RD and TD during dynamic impact.Typical <10-10>∥ED fiber texture is formed during thermal extrusion of TC1 titanium rod, and annealing reinforces the <10-10>∥ED fiber texture intensely. The results of static tension and compression and dynamic impact show that elongation percentage and contraction cross sectional area are 25% and 36% respectively. Many twins are found to coordinate the external deformation during compression and dynamic impact, and the number in the extruded specimen is apparently larger than that in the as-received specimen during dynamic impact. In addition, both specimens perform different effect rate effects.
